When Prometrium is used
Prometrium is approved for endometrial protection in postmenopausal women receiving estrogen, secondary amenorrhoea and selected ART indications.
When Doxycycline is used

Mechanisms compared
Prometrium: Progesterone in Prometrium binds to progesterone receptors and modulates gene expression in reproductive and other tissues. Doxycycline: Doxycycline reversibly binds the 30S ribosomal subunit of susceptible bacteria, inhibiting protein synthesis by preventing the binding of aminoacyl-tRNA to the ribosomal A site.
